Transaction d64e86c16939422cec35ae835f42965f07ecc79173e018d38d67bb12e7822330
1 Input
1 Output
-
d64e86c16939422cec35ae835f42965f07ecc79173e018d38d67bb12e7822330:0
- value
- 1511270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f03e239ceb8b7194604fc15b593423b78288397a OP_EQUAL
- address
- 3PbJY5qw2NVJQrMBaZsMccvE28D6C4sc4t